Работа с электронными таблицами часто требует вычисления долей от общего числа, будь то анализ продаж, подсчет налогов или оценка выполнения плана. Многие пользователи сталкиваются с трудностями, когда пытаются понять, как создать формулу процента в Экселе, чтобы программа автоматически отображала результат в нужном формате. Ошибки в синтаксисе или неправильный формат ячейки могут привести к тому, что вместо ожидаемого значения вы получите десятичную дробь или ошибку вычисления.
В этой статье мы подробно разберем механику вычислений в Microsoft Excel и его аналогах. Вы научитесь не только находить процент от числа, но и определять долю одного значения в другом, а также рассчитывать изменение показателей во времени. Понимание базовых принципов позволит вам автоматизировать рутинные задачи и минимизировать риск ручного пересчета данных.
Для успешного освоения материала вам не потребуются глубокие знания математики, достаточно уметь выполнять базовые арифметические операции. Мы рассмотрим различные сценарии использования, от простого деления до сложных формул с абсолютными ссылками. Главное — правильно задать алгоритм действий для программы.
Базовый принцип расчета доли в Excel
Фундаментом любой процентной вычислительной операции является деление. Чтобы найти, какую часть составляет одно число от другого, необходимо разделить часть на целое. В Excel этот процесс выглядит так же, как и в обычной математике, но результат часто требует дополнительного форматирования для корректного отображения.
Когда вы вводите формулу деления, программа по умолчанию выдает десятичную дробь. Например, если разделить 50 на 200, вы получите 0,25. Для человека это не всегда очевидно, поэтому критически важно преобразовать значение в процентный формат. Это делается либо через меню форматирования, либо путем умножения результата на 100.
Рассмотрим простой пример: у вас есть общая сумма продаж и сумма, проданная одним менеджером. Вам нужно узнать его эффективность. Формула будет выглядеть как отношение проданного менеджером товара к общему объему. После ввода равенства и деления чисел, результат необходимо отформатировать, выбрав соответствующий стиль в группе"Число".
- 📊 Выделите ячейку с результатом вычисления.
- 🖱️ Нажмите правой кнопкой мыши и выберите"Формат ячеек".
- 🔢 В списке категорий найдите и выберите"Процентный".
- ✅ Укажите желаемое количество знаков после запятой для точности.
⚠️ Внимание: Если вы просто умножите число на 100 в формуле, но не примените процентный формат, вы получите число 25 вместо 25%, что может запутать при дальнейших расчетах.
Это означает, что при использовании полученных значений в дальнейших вычислениях (например, при умножении на другую сумму) вам не нужно снова делить их на 100. Программа сделает это автоматически, если формат ячейки установлен верно.
Как посчитать процент от числа в Excel
Часто возникает обратная задача: известно общее число и процент, который нужно от него найти. Например, необходимо рассчитать сумму налога НДС или размер скидки при распродаже. В этом случае формула строится путем умножения исходного числа на искомый процент.
Синтаксис такой операции предельно прост. В ячейке результата вы ставите знак равенства, указываете ссылку на базовое число (или вводите его вручную), затем знак умножения и значение процента. Если процент введен как число с символом"%", Excel сам поймет, что это доля единицы.
Допустим, цена товара составляет 1500 рублей, а скидка равна 20%. Чтобы найти сумму скидки, нужно умножить 1500 на 20%. Результатом будет 300. Если же вам нужно найти итоговую цену со скидкой, формула усложняется: от исходной цены отнимается рассчитанная сумма скидки.
При работе с большими таблицами удобно использовать абсолютные ссылки. Если ставка налога или размер скидки фиксированы для всего столбца, закрепите ячейку с процентом знаками доллара (например, $C$1). Это позволит протянуть формулу вниз без риска сдвига ссылки на процент.
☑️ Проверка формулы умножения
Расчет изменения показателей в процентах
Аналитика данных невозможна без оценки динамики. Вам может потребоваться узнать, на сколько процентов выросла прибыль в этом месяце по сравнению с прошлым или как изменилась численность сотрудников. Для этого используется формула разности, деленной на исходное значение.
Математически это выглядит так: (Новое значение - Старое значение) / Старое значение. В Excel вы вычитаете из ячейки с текущими данными ячейку с прошлыми данными, а затем делите полученную разницу на значение прошлого периода. Результат обязательно форматируется как процент.
Положительное значение укажет на рост, а отрицательное — на падение показателя. Например, если в январе продали 100 единиц, а в феврале 120, то рост составит 20%. Если же в марте продали 90 единиц, то по сравнению с февралем будет падение на 25%.
| Месяц | Продажи (шт) | Изменение (%) | Формула |
|---|---|---|---|
| Январь | 100 | - | - |
| Февраль | 120 | 20% | =(B3-B2)/B2 |
| Март | 90 | -25% | =(B4-B3)/B3 |
| Апрель | 110 | 22.2% | =(B5-B4)/B4 |
При копировании такой формулы вниз по столбцу важно следить за относительными ссылками. Excel автоматически адаптирует адреса ячеек для каждой строки, что делает этот метод идеальным для анализа временных рядов и отчетов.
Работа с функциями СУММЕСЛИ и ДОЛЯ
В более сложных сценариях требуется сначала отфильтровать данные по определенному критерию, а затем посчитать их долю. Например, нужно узнать, какую процентную долю в общей выручке составляют продажи конкретного товара или менеджера. Здесь на помощь приходят функции семейства SUMIF (СУММЕСЛИ).
Сначала вычисляем сумму значений, удовлетворяющих условию, используя функцию СУММЕСЛИ. Затем делим этот результат на общую сумму всех значений, которую можно получить с помощью функции СУММ. Полученная дробь и будет искомым процентом.
Рассмотрим пример: в столбце А указаны имена менеджеров, в столбце B — их продажи. Нам нужно найти долю продаж менеджера"Иванов". Формула будет выглядеть так: =СУММЕСЛИ(A:A;"Иванов"; B:B) / СУММ(B:B). Не забудьте применить процентный формат к ячейке с формулой.
- 🔍 Укажите диапазон, где искать имя (критерий).
- 📝 Запишите критерий поиска (имя или ссылку на ячейку).
- 💰 Укажите диапазон суммирования (числовые значения).
- ➗ Разделите результат на общую сумму столбца продаж.
⚠️ Внимание: При использовании текстовых критериев в формулах обязательно заключайте текст в кавычки. Если критерий находится в другой ячейке, кавычки не нужны, используется ссылка.
Такой подход позволяет создавать динамические отчеты. Изменяя имя менеджера в ячейке критерия, вы будете мгновенно получать актуальную статистику его вклада в общий результат без необходимости пересчитывать данные вручную.
Ошибки при расчетах и их устранение
Даже при правильной логике вычислений пользователи часто сталкиваются с ошибками отображения или неверными результатами. Одна из самых распространенных проблем — появление символов решетки (#####) в ячейке. Это не ошибка формулы, а indication того, что ширина столбца недостаточна для отображения числа.
Другая частая проблема — получение результата 0% или 100% там, где их быть не должно. Это случается, если пользователь забыл, что Excel воспринимает проценты как доли единицы. Ввод числа"5" вместо"5%" или"0,05" приведет к умножению на 500%, что исказит данные.
Также стоит обратить внимание на ошибки деления на ноль (#ДЕЛ/0!). Они возникают, если знаменатель в вашей формуле (общее число или значение прошлого периода) равен нулю или пуст. Чтобы избежать появления страшных кодов ошибок в отчете, используйте функцию ЕСЛИОШИБКА.
Как скрыть ошибки деления на ноль?
Используйте конструкцию: =ЕСЛИОШИБКА(Ваша_формула;""). Второй аргумент (пустые кавычки) instructs Excel отображать пустую ячейку вместо кода ошибки, если вычисление невозможно.
Для отладки сложных формул используйте инструмент"Зависимости" на вкладке"Формулы". Он визуально покажет стрелками, из каких ячеек берутся данные для текущего расчета, что помогает быстро найти неверного значения.
Абсолютные и относительные ссылки в процентах
Эффективная работа с таблицами невозможна без понимания разницы между типами ссылок. Когда вы создаете формулу процента и планируете копировать её на другие ячейки, поведение ссылок становится критическим. Относительные ссылки меняются при копировании, абсолютные — остаются зафиксированными.
Представьте, что у вас есть столбец с ценами и одна ячейка с текущим курсом доллара или ставкой НДС. При расчете налога для каждой позиции цены вам нужно, чтобы ссылка на ставку всегда вела на одну и ту же ячейку. Для этого используются знаки доллара ($) перед названием столбца и строки.
Например, ссылка $C$1 является полностью абсолютной. Куда бы вы ни скопировали формулу, она всегда будет брать значение из ячейки C1. Если же написать C1 (относительная), то при копировании вниз ссылка сместится на C2, C3 и так далее, что приведет к ошибкам, если в тех ячейках нет нужных данных.
Для быстрой установки знаков доллара при редактировании формулы используйте клавишу F4. Нажатие этой кнопки циклически переключает типы ссылок: абсолютная, смешанная (фиксирован столбец), смешанная (фиксирована строка) и относительная.
Освоив этот прием, вы сможете создавать универсальные шаблоны расчетов, где изменение одного параметра (например, ставки налога) автоматически обновит результаты во всей таблице из тысяч строк.
Почему Excel показывает проценты как десятичные дроби?
Это внутреннее представление данных программой. Для компьютера 25% — это просто 0,25. Форматирование ячейки лишь меняет визуальное отображение, умножая число на 100 и добавляя знак %, но само хранящееся значение остается десятичной дробью для точности вычислений.
Как быстро скопировать формат процента на другие ячейки?
Используйте инструмент"Формат по образцу" (кисточка) на вкладке"Главная". Выделите ячейку с правильным процентным форматом, нажмите на кисточку и проведите по целевому диапазону. Также можно использовать горячие клавиши Ctrl+Shift+%.
Можно ли складывать проценты в Excel?
Да, можно. Поскольку для Excel это обычные числа (0,1 + 0,2 = 0,3), арифметические операции выполняются корректно. Однако следите за логикой: складывать проценты от разных базовых чисел математически неверно, хотя технически Excel это сделает без ошибок.